President Bhandari appoints two residential ambassadors to Egypt and Vienna



KATHMANDU: President Bidya Devi Bhandari appointed two residential Nepali ambassadors to Egypt and Austria.

President Bhandari appointed Sushil Kumar Lamsal for Egypt and Bharat Kumar Regmi for Austria as well as Nepal’s permanent representatives for United Nations Office in Vienna, according to the Office of the President, Shital Niwas.

The appointment by the Head of the State was made in accordance with the Article 282 (1) of the Constitution of Nepal and at the recommendations of the Council of Ministers, informed Shital Niwas.
